‘We’ve been lied to!’ Congresswoman Hageman Sounds The Alarm: SPLC, KKK claims and MASSIVE Fraud
Winston Marshall ^ | 2/5/26 | Harriet Hageman

Posted on 05/04/2026 5:31:50 AM PDT by Eleutheria5

In this episode of The Winston Marshall Show, I sit down with Harriet Hageman for a controversial conversation on corruption, immigration, foreign policy, and free speech.

Hageman lays out explosive claims surrounding alleged fraud involving the Southern Poverty Law Centre, arguing that the organisation fabricated and funded extremist activity while profiting from it. We unpack the broader implications of those allegations, the role of media narratives, and what potential indictments could reveal.

The conversation then turns to what she describes as systemic fraud tied to mass migration, focusing on Minnesota and the Somali community. Hageman argues that failures of governance, weak enforcement, and political incentives have enabled billions in alleged misuse of public funds, raising questions about accountability, assimilation, and the limits of current immigration policy.

We also explore the geopolitical landscape, including the escalating conflict with Iran, rising energy prices, and the strategic decisions shaping US foreign policy. Hageman defends a hardline approach, arguing that long-term global stability outweighs short-term economic pain.

Finally, we examine the growing tensions around free speech in the West from the United States to Europe and what she sees as a coordinated push to restrict open debate, both by governments and institutions.
